Did Han Xin, a famous general in the early Han Dynasty, die by suicide or homicide?

2021/08/1711:35:05 history 2407

Han Xin was a great hero of Liu Bang's founding of the country, but he ended up miserably. He was killed by , Lvhou and Xiao He. It can be said that Han Xin died of homicide. But why do I have the question of "suicide or homicide"? Because I discovered that Han Xin has been consciously seeking his own way at the end of his life, and has been tempting others to do something to himself.

Han Xin was demoted to Huaiyin Hou , Fan Kui went to see him. Han Xin sighed: "Unexpectedly, Han Xin would still be with you, Fan Kuai?" This is not a casual sentence. You know, Fan Kuai is the brother-in-law of Emperor Liu Bang and a proper relative of the emperor. In case Fan Kuai “put on small shoes” for Han Xin in front of Liu Bang, enough to drink a pot for him. This is Han Xin's first search for death.

One day, Han Xin chatted with Liu Bang. Han Xin said that Liu Bang can bring 100,000 soldiers, but he is "the more the better." Fortunately, Liu Bang had a big measure, otherwise Han Xin'an could be charged with "great disrespect" and he would be accused of disrespect. Not only that, Han Xin also said that Liu Bang was “not good at leading troops and good at commanding generals.” Doesn’t this mean that Liu Bang has no serious skills and can only play conspiracies? This is Han Xin's second search for death.

There is a general named Chen Zhu who was sent to defend the side. Before leaving, Han Xin fought him against rebellion and said that he would respond to him. Chen Zhu reversed, and Liu Bang drove him personally. Later, Han Xin's family reported him. Hou Lu and Xiao He deceived him into the palace, which ended in his life. This was Han Xin's third thought, and he finally died.

Although Han Xin is dead, he is definitely not reconciled, because he originally wanted to die by Liu Bang's hand, and gave Liu Bang a label of "dead rabbit, good dog cooking". Liu Bang deprived him of his prince. He was unwilling and wanted to retaliate, but he suffered from the lack of an army. He could only find a little "psychological comfort" through labeling. It’s a pity that the sky did not fulfill the wishes, Xiao He and Lu Hou came out halfway,Blocked the gun for Liu Bang.
